Fixed prices
| Job | From | Typical time | What sets the price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Single item collection | £45 | 20–40 min | One mattress, sofa or appliance carried out and weighed in at a licensed transfer station. |
| Minimum load (approx. 1.5 cubic yards) | £95 | 20–30 min | A few bags and a couple of items — priced on the space taken, not on a call-out fee. |
| Quarter-load (approx. 3 cubic yards) | £120 | 30–60 min | The usual size for a flat clear-down: bagged waste, a bed frame and some boxes. |
| Half-load (approx. 6 cubic yards) | £200 | 1–2 hrs | A garage or loft clear-down, still one van and two crew. |
| Full Luton load (approx. 12 cubic yards) | £380 | 2–4 hrs | Full van, two crew, the transfer-station charge and the waste transfer note included. |
| Garden or builders' waste, per cubic yard | £70 | By volume | Soil, rubble and hardcore are capped by weight rather than space — heavy loads cost more per yard. |

Domestic prices are the total you pay. Commercial and landlord invoices are quoted plus VAT at 20%. Permits, bay suspensions, ULEZ and the Congestion Charge, where they apply, are itemised in the written quote before the crew is booked.
